FAQ About Electric Bikes

What is an electric bike?

An electric bike, or e-bike, is a bicycle equipped with a rechargeable battery, electric motor, and controls that provide assistance while you ride. Depending on the model and local rules, that assistance may come through pedal assist, a throttle, or both. You can still pedal it like a regular bicycle when the motor is not in use.

How do electric bikes work?

An e-bike's battery supplies power to the motor through a controller. Pedal-assist models add power when you pedal, while throttle-equipped models can deliver power from a handlebar control. The rider selects the assistance level; depending on the system, assistance stops when you stop pedaling, release the throttle, brake, or reach the configured limit.

How much does an electric bike cost?

Electric bikes can cost from under $1,000 to several thousand dollars. Price is mainly affected by battery capacity, motor system, frame, brakes, and suspension. Macfox models shown on this page currently start at $1,099; check the product cards above for current prices, promotions, and battery options.

How fast do electric bikes go?

In the common U.S. three-class system, Class 1 and Class 2 motor assistance ends at 20 mph, while Class 3 pedal assistance ends at 28 mph. Macfox models on this page list a 20 mph top speed. Applicable rules and permitted riding locations vary by state and locality.

Do you need a license for an electric bike?

Many standard e-bikes do not require a driver's license, registration, or insurance, but the rule is not uniform across the United States. Requirements can depend on the state, locality, bike classification, rider age, and where you ride. Check current state and local regulations before riding.

Are electric bikes street legal?

E-bikes are street legal only when the bike and its use comply with applicable state and local rules. Classification, assisted speed, throttle use, rider age, helmet requirements, and permitted roads or paths can all matter. A bike allowed on a road may still be restricted on sidewalks, trails, or multi-use paths.

Do you have to pedal an electric bike?

Not always. Pedal-assist e-bikes require pedaling for the motor to assist, while throttle-equipped e-bikes can provide power without pedaling where throttle use is permitted. Macfox models on this page include a thumb throttle and can also be pedaled.

How far can an electric bike go on one charge?

Range changes with battery configuration, assist level, rider and cargo weight, terrain, temperature, tire pressure, and stop-and-go riding. Macfox models on this page list 25-40 miles with a single battery and up to 56-80 miles with available dual-battery setups on select models. Actual range will vary.

How long does it take to charge an electric bike?

Macfox models on this page list charge times of about 5-7 hours, depending on the model and battery. Use only the supplied or manufacturer-recommended charger, stay nearby while charging, and unplug the charger when charging is complete.

Can you ride an electric bike in the rain?

Some water-resistant e-bikes can be ridden in light rain if the model instructions permit it, but water-resistant does not mean waterproof. Check the bike's stated protection and manual, avoid deep water, submersion, and pressure washing, and make sure electrical components are dry before charging.

How much do electric bikes weigh?

Electric bikes are usually heavier than conventional bicycles because of the motor, battery, frame, and wider tires. Current Macfox models on this page weigh about 65-87 lb. Check the exact model specifications if you need to lift the bike, carry it upstairs, or use a vehicle rack.

Are electric bikes safe?

Electric bikes can be safe when correctly sized, maintained, and ridden within local rules. Wear a bicycle helmet, check the brakes, tires, throttle, lights, battery, and frame before riding, and use only approved batteries and chargers. Do not make unauthorized changes to the battery or electronic control system.
